just curious, how's this diff from lc's co-op share mode? u can j create a room and send the link to anyone who needs it

sinful flicker
#

with coop share mode, you share the same editor and work on the same problem. The problem I'm trying to solve is you can work on a problem at your own pace, while still being able to connect with others and see what they're working on. I imagine additional features here would be to gamify your LC experience, i.e race to see who complete the problem first, etc. Does that make sense?
